Small wine-country vila in the Ave region of Portugal, Serzedelo sits close to the water and within reach of the mountains, with a café and restaurant scene that punches above its size. Its parish church, probably dating to the 12th century, is a well-preserved example of Romanesque architecture, and the settlement itself appears in documents from 1038. Guimarães, a short drive away, anchors a wider region rich in UNESCO World Heritage sites.
